About the role
We’re looking for someone who is excited by what data can enable and wants to help shape today’s most exciting industry. You’ll be part of the team responsible for analyzing and understanding our Global Inventory Data, strengthening our competitive position in our Global Offering. As a Data Analyst, you will help ensure our best data is available in global products, enabling organizations to make informed decisions and achieve business success. This role includes working closely with cross-functional teams to analyze and map local data to global products. You will collaborate with stakeholders to create data mappings, reporting, insights, root-cause analyses, and drive continuous improvement.
Key Responsibilities

  • Develop a strong understanding of Dun & Bradstreet’s inventory data.
  • Become proficient in and act as a subject matter expert on our global data transfer structure.
  • Conduct detailed analysis and troubleshoot data incidents related to data flows from local markets to global systems.
  • Provide analysis support to members of the regional data owner teams.
  • Develop and maintain reference materials and explanatory documentation on data topics.
  • Use advanced data analysis and profiling techniques.
  • Work within data models that store data in an organized structure.
  • Use PowerBI and/or Looker to design, build, connect, and administer dashboards based on data quality monitoring results.
  • Communicate with globally distributed stakeholders using JIRA and Confluence.
  • Capture requirements accurately and build a strong understanding of use cases.
  • Produce regular reports on data quality metrics.
  • Review data to identify patterns or trends that may signal processing errors.
  • Maintain thorough documentation of data quality processes and findings.
  • Follow data governance policies and procedures.
  • Continuously learn about industry best practices and technologies related to data quality.
Required Traits Include

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, or a related field.
  • 2+ years of experience with demonstrated in-depth knowledge of data analysis, query languages, data modelling, and the software development life cycle.
  • Strong SQL skills (preferably BigQuery).
  • Agile mindset and understanding of agile project management (Scrum/Kanban).
  • Knowledge of database design, modelling, and best practices.
  • Experience with cloud technologies (preferably GCP).
  • Experience with PowerBI, Looker, or a similar data visualization tool.
  • Analytical thinking, process improvement, and problem-solving skills.
  • Good communication skills and the ability to clearly explain data issues and solutions.
  • Commitment to meet deadlines, uphold the release schedule, and demonstrate strong teamwork.
Valuable Traits Include

  • Skills in Python and/or Scala for data wrangling and data analysis.
  • Experience with data observability tools such as Acceldata or Informatica DQ.
  • Experience working with XML and JSON data structures.
  • Understanding of ETL processes and their impact on data quality.
  • Knowledge of machine learning, especially anomaly detection.
  • Experience collaborating across time zones as part of a global team.
